A Laois mother feels she's wasted 22 years advocating for mental health services.
Occupational therapists are being redeployed within the HSE to carry out covid-19 tests and tracing, with the Junior Health Minister saying it could be months before they return to they normal roles.
Mary Dunne - from Laois Offaly Families For Autism - says they've reached desperation point, with children already waiting four years or more to see a therapist.
